Core Functionality and Technical Architecture
The primary strength of this add-on lies in its ability to decouple content definition from the core mod logic. In traditional setups, altering drop rates, growth speeds, or tier requirements often requires waiting for an official update or utilizing complex CraftTweaker scripts that can be fragile. Mystical Customization: Customize Magical Farming in Minecraft simplifies this by exposing data structures directly to the user through readable text files. This approach ensures that changes are transparent, version-controllable, and easy to troubleshoot.
Key capabilities include:
- Crop Creation and Editing: Define entirely new plant species or modify existing ones to fit custom lore or resource needs.
- Tier Management: Adjust the hierarchy of crops, controlling when players access inferior, standard, or superior variations based on their progression stage.
- Type Specification: Assign specific resource types to crops, ensuring they integrate correctly with other mods that rely on ore dictionary tags or specific item IDs.
- Mob Soul Integration: Configure how mob souls interact with farming mechanics, allowing for complex breeding loops or automated soul collection systems.
This level of granularity is particularly vital for modpacks where economy and crafting chains are tightly interwoven. By manipulating these variables, creators can prevent early-game inflation of rare resources or ensure that end-game materials remain a significant achievement rather than a trivial byproduct of automated farms.
Strategic Balance and Progression Control
Balancing a modded Minecraft environment is a delicate act. It involves managing the flow of resources to maintain engagement without causing frustration. With Mystical Customization: Customize Magical Farming in Minecraft, server owners can fine-tune the tempo of resource acquisition. For instance, in a survival series intended to last several months, you might configure lower-tier crops to have slower growth rates or higher seed costs, forcing players to invest more time in infrastructure before achieving full automation.
Conversely, for creative testing environments or fast-paced minigames, the same tool can be used to accelerate production rates and lower tier barriers. The ability to segment crops by development stages allows for a structured release of content. Players might start with basic stone and iron seeds in the overworld, only unlocking nether-tier or ender-tier crops after defeating specific bosses or exploring dangerous dimensions. This creates a logical narrative flow where farming evolves alongside the player's technological and magical prowess.

Best Practices for Configuration
To maximize stability and achieve the desired gameplay experience, a methodical approach to configuration is recommended. Administrators should avoid attempting to overhaul the entire crop list in a single session. Instead, begin by adjusting key resources that drive your server's economy. Test these changes in a isolated world to verify that drop rates and growth ticks behave as expected before deploying them to a live environment.
- Backup Regularly: Always create copies of your JSON files before making significant edits to prevent data loss or syntax errors.
- Consistent Naming: Adhere to a strict naming convention for crops and tiers to ensure clarity for both players and future maintainers of the pack.
- Documentation: Maintain a changelog or design document explaining the logic behind specific balance decisions, which helps in troubleshooting and team collaboration.
- Version Checking: Verify that the version of Mystical Customization: Customize Magical Farming in Minecraft for Minecraft matches your game version and the base mod version to prevent crashes.
